Summary, etc. | It is time for a paradigm shift in our study of world capitalism and the global ruling class. The statecentrism informing much theorization and analysis of world politics, political economy, and class structure is less and less congruent with 21st century world developments. Global capitalism represents a new stage in the ongoing and open-ended evolution of world capitalism, characterized by the rise of transnational capital and a globally integrated production and financial system commanded by a transnational capitalist class, or TCC, that attempts to exercise its class power through transnational state apparatuses. The TCC, as the new global ruling class, has been attempting, albeit with limited success, to construct a global hegemonic bloc in which one group, the TCC, exercises leadership and imposes its project through the consent of those drawn into the bloc, while those from the majority who are not drawn into this hegemonic project, either through material rewards or ideological mechanisms, are contained or repressed. Global capitalism is in crisis. A popular revolt is spreading worldwide, thus posing many challenges. Transformative struggles must be informed by an accurate analysis of global capitalism and its ruling class. |
